Three New Spots To Recommend
Although I thoroughly enjoy serving as Mayor, you may have noticed that my real dream-job is restaurant reviewer. Here are this month’s selections. A gold star for the first.
Gnarly Vine
www.thegnarlyvine.com
501 Main Street, New Rochelle, NY 10801
914-355-2541
A great new wine bar with a Manhattan-feel. The menu is composed mostly of small plates, all delicious and creative, and a few together can be shared to make a very full meal. Plenty of wine selections by the glass or the bottle. The website doesn’t do the place justice. Exactly what many have wanted in downtown New Rochelle. Be sure to go.
Steam-Eat
www.steam-eat.com
179 East Main Street, New Rochelle, NY 10801
914-355-2063
Located in the “turret” of the Huguenot Hills development, Steam-Eat features an eclectic menu of casual items, from salads, to sandwiches, to pizza and wraps (almost all with creative, gourmet touches) not to mention great coffee. There’s also a nice outdoor seating area, which should be especially pleasant come the Spring.
AJ’s Burgers
542 North Avenue, New Rochelle, NY 10801
914-235-3009
A perfect burger joint, also featuring ribs, chicken, salads, and other all-American fare. If you eat-in, your meal will be served in a skillet — a cute touch. The owners did a wonderful job of renovating a North Avenue storefront, just across from City Hall. AJ’s offers take-out and is also kid-friendly.
